summaryrefslogtreecommitdiff
path: root/utils/genapply
diff options
context:
space:
mode:
authorBen Gamari <ben@smart-cactus.org>2017-04-21 09:16:48 -0400
committerBen Gamari <ben@smart-cactus.org>2017-04-28 22:35:04 -0400
commit945c45ad50ed31e3acb96fdaafb21640c4669f12 (patch)
treeae2e59ba8d3a49bbd3c3dcece39d53aef691ed44 /utils/genapply
parente5b3492f23c2296d0d8221e1787ee585331f726e (diff)
downloadhaskell-945c45ad50ed31e3acb96fdaafb21640c4669f12.tar.gz
Prefer #if defined to #ifdef
Our new CPP linter enforces this.
Diffstat (limited to 'utils/genapply')
-rw-r--r--utils/genapply/Main.hs4
1 files changed, 2 insertions, 2 deletions
diff --git a/utils/genapply/Main.hs b/utils/genapply/Main.hs
index f9d6ea1e3f..90ae5d7ac0 100644
--- a/utils/genapply/Main.hs
+++ b/utils/genapply/Main.hs
@@ -257,7 +257,7 @@ stackCheck regstatus args args_in_regs fun_info_label (prof_sp, norm_sp) =
char '}'
| otherwise = empty
in
- vcat [ text "#ifdef PROFILING",
+ vcat [ text "#if defined(PROFILING)",
cmp_sp prof_sp,
text "#else",
cmp_sp norm_sp,
@@ -392,7 +392,7 @@ genMkPAP regstatus macro jump live ticker disamb
shuffle_extra_args = (doc, (shuffle_prof_stack, shuffle_norm_stack))
where
- doc = vcat [ text "#ifdef PROFILING",
+ doc = vcat [ text "#if defined(PROFILING)",
shuffle_prof_doc,
text "#else",
shuffle_norm_doc,